Way too many variables there.

You just have to get on the dyno and play with them. If you are looking for all top end, the settings will be different than if you want midrange. It all depends on what you are shooting for. And a GS-R block will have different "likes" as far as cam timing oes than a straight R motor.

On my bolt-on only car, the best settings for me were +1 intake, -4 exhaust. I got decent gains all around, with the emphasis on top end.
